Abstract
MORENO CARRILLO, Atilio and AGUILAR RODAS, María Paola. Some Bioethical Concepts to Consider in the Emergency Room. Univ. Med. [online]. 2019, vol.60, n.3, pp.69-75. ISSN 0041-9095. https://doi.org/10.11144/javeriana.umed60-3.cbsu.
In the field of medicine and even more in the emergency room physicians are constantly exposed to ethycal dilemas wich without solid concepts are hard to solve, eventhough there are some principles like: beneficence, non-maleficence, autonomy and justice, and also codes like the American College of Emergency Physicians Code of Ethics for emergency physicians, there is not an standard in this practice because such situations are as variable as patients. In this article we analyze the most common circumstances and we give some basis to follow on this cases.
